Overview
Navegante is a generic framework to build superior order proxies for
intrusive browsing. This framework provides the means for developing
tools that behave as proxies, but perform some processing task on
the content that is being browsed. Parallel to this content processing,
applications can also run other user-defined functions with different
purposes and interfaces, but we'll explain those later. Currently,
Navegante only builds applications that run as CGIs, but this is intended
to change in a near future. Applications are built writing programs in
Navegante's Domain Specific Language (DSL).
